Welcome to Jowhale’s Vegan Kitchen! I’m Jowhale–a queer feminist vegan who is obsessed with whales, aliens, and coffee. Some of you may know me through my other social media accounts such as my film blog: ManicPixieDragonBlossoms.tumblr.com or my Vine account: @Jowhale.
I’m creating Jowhale’s Vegan Kitchen as a space to share my favorite original recipes. This will be a place to find delicious new dinner ideas, an easier way to make those meals you always hate to make, and hopefully a sense of community.
I went vegan in 2008 and have never looked back. For me, being a vegan is just such an conditioned part of my life, that often I forget I eat differently from most people. I decided to make the change to veganism when I learned about the cruel injustices inflicted upon animals raised for meat, dairy, and eggs. Soon after, I discovered how horrific animal agriculture is for our environment and for our planet. I’m passionate for all people, all animals, and the earth itself–and that’s why I live a vegan lifestyle.
Whether you are vegan, vegetarian, meat-eater–this blog will have many mouth-watering dishes to keep you coming back for more killer vegan food!

My name is Joey. I am 28 years-old and I currently reside in the small, picturesque town of Santa Cruz, California. I have been wanting to start a journal for a while now, but since I live a pretty normal life, I was discouraged to do it. What would I write about if nothing exciting even happens?
Well, something exciting is happening. I’m going to be vegan.
You’re probably thinking what made me want to go vegan. I have two very close friends who are vegan (Hi Desiree and Joelle!) and I have been wanting to do this for a while now too.
Sidenote: “Wanting to do things” has been a constant in my life for a while. I’ve been wanting to start a journal/blog. I have been wanting to go vegan. I have been wanting to travel more. I have been wanting to skydive. Basically 2016 will be the year of less wanting and more doing, and it’s going to start with being vegan.
But back to why I’m doing this. Partly to help the environment, partly for a healthier lifestyle, but mostly for animal rights. Have you ever seen someone getting bullied, but you don’t say anything and then just walk by. That’s basically how I feel when I’m eating a hamburger. That poor cow was probably confined, beaten, and then hung upside down while its throat was split open.
You should know that I have pretty unhealthy eating habits, so this transition will be pretty difficult. But I am prepared to do it and I will be documenting it every step of the way. By blogging, I’m hoping to connect with more vegans out there and hopefully get some advice along the way.
